𝗟𝗶𝗳𝗲𝗴𝘂𝗮𝗿𝗱

Current RLSSA Pool Lifeguard Award or ability to complete Pool Lifeguard Licensing requirements (within 21 days of commencing duties)
Current nationally recognised accredited First Aid Award

𝗟𝗲𝗮𝗿𝗻 𝘁𝗼 𝗦𝘄𝗶𝗺

Current AUSTSWIM, Royal Life Saving Society Australia or Swimming Australia Certificate - Teacher of Swimming & Water Safety (or equivalent)
Current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ation Award or RLSSA Pool Lifeguard Award (CPR)
